Abstract

Intelligence Activity is supported by its own doctrine, which guides and disciplines the handling of sensitive material, the object of its use in the development of the knowledge construction process. It has a specific, unique language, whose mastery is essential for professionals in the field, as well as for the users of their work, providing unity of thought, procedure, and language. The intelligence doctrine consists of a set of principles, concepts, norms, values, and ethical assumptions that govern the Activity, mainly regarding the behavior of its professionals. It is characterized by its normative content, the dynamism of its principles, the absence of dogmas, the consensual acceptance of its precepts, and the unity of thought, procedure, and language among professionals in the field. Mastery of this language is essential for intelligence work to proceed without distortions or misunderstandings, as some expressions correspond to what they actually represent, while others have a special meaning that requires deeper understanding. The differences between data, information, and knowledge for intelligence were highlighted, as these distinctions are also relevant in other areas of knowledge. The work utilized an exploratory methodology and theoretical review to obtain its results. At the end of the research, it was concluded that the information activity is guided by principles and characteristics that direct it. The principles identified were interaction, scope, objectivity, secrecy, opportunity, permanence, precision, compartmentalization, simplicity, control, and impartiality. The characteristics obtained were knowledge production, advisory, truth with meaning, data gathering, security, dynamics, coverage, initiative, economy of resources, and specialized actions. It was possible to better understand the pillars of an activity that, although secretive, is present in the daily life of Brazilians, even though they are often unaware of what is happening.
